Detailed Description
The Neo Tools Aluminium Spirit Level, 120 cm, 2 Vials is a precision instrument designed for ensuring the horizontality and verticality of surfaces in various applications, including construction and DIY projects.
This high-quality, durable tool made from aluminum is known for its excellent measurement accuracy and robust construction. It is designed to provide reliable results, making it a valuable asset for both professional contractors and DIY enthusiasts.
Technical Specifications
- Length: 120 cm
- Material: Aluminum
- Number of Vials: 2
- Accuracy: ±0.5 mm/m (0.029°)
- Profile Thickness: 1 mm
- Dimensions: 51.5 x 20.5 x 1200 mm
- Density: 0.395 kg/m³ (approximate)
